COMMITS
February 10, 2026
M
Merge pull request #1210 from immerjs/bugfix/1209-array-plugin-nested-drafts
Mark Erikson committed
M
fix: handle nested proxies after spreading and inserting into an array
Mark Erikson committed
December 29, 2025
H
chore(__tests__): add vitest globals to tsconfig.json (#1196)
Homa Wong committed
H
fix: recursive T for WritableDraft (#1197)
Homa Wong committed
M
fix: bogus commit to retest release
Michel Weststrate committed
December 28, 2025
M
December 23, 2025
M
Merge pull request #1198 from immerjs/feature/array-plugin-docs
Mark Erikson committed
M
Actually add array plugin to docs
Mark Erikson committed
December 20, 2025
D
chore(deps-dev): bump vite from 5.4.20 to 5.4.21 (#1185)
dependabot[bot] committed
D
chore(deps): bump node-forge from 1.3.1 to 1.3.3 in /website (#1195)
dependabot[bot] committed
M
[docs] Documented setUseStrictIteration
Michel Weststrate committed
December 19, 2025
M
feat: Override array methods to avoid proxy creation while iterating and updating (#1184)
Mark Erikson committed
November 28, 2025
M
fix: (dummy fix to release freeze fix per #1193)
Michel Weststrate committed
November 27, 2025
M
Merge pull request #1193 from immerjs/bugfix/1192-non-draftable-values
Mark Erikson committed
M
Re-add isDraftable check to skip freezing non-obj values
Mark Erikson committed
November 23, 2025
M
October 27, 2025
M
Merge pull request #1187 from immerjs/feature/more-benchmarks-3
Mark Erikson committed
M
Tweak perf output formatting
Mark Erikson committed
M
Add second large object test to check v8 non-fast properties
Mark Erikson committed
M
Merge pull request #1186 from immerjs/feature/more-benchmarks-2
Mark Erikson committed
October 14, 2025
M
Add largeObject and mapNested benchmarks
Mark Erikson committed
October 25, 2025
M
feat: Optimize Immer performance where possible, introduce `setUseStrictIteration` (#1164)
Mark Erikson committed
October 6, 2025
M
Merge pull request #1182 from immerjs/feature/more-perf-benchmarks
Mark Erikson committed
M
Add benchmark table and comparison output
Mark Erikson committed
M
Add reuse and RTKQ benchmark scenarios
Mark Erikson committed
M
Pull out freeze values
Mark Erikson committed
M
Improve filtering test
Mark Erikson committed
M
Add benchmark config
Mark Erikson committed
M
Add structura and limu as versions
Mark Erikson committed
M
Read latest CPU profile by default
Mark Erikson committed